• What battery chemistry does the Deye SE-F Series use?
  • The Deye SE-F Series uses Lithium Iron Phosphate (LiFePO4) battery chemistry with an advanced battery management system.
  • What energy capacities are available in the SE-F Series?
  • The series is available in nominal energy capacities of 5.12kWh, 12.03kWh, and 16kWh, depending on the selected model.
  • What is the nominal battery voltage?
  • All models operate at a nominal voltage of 51.2V, with an operating voltage range of 44.8V to 57.6V.
  • How many battery units can be connected in parallel?
  • The SE-F Series supports up to 32 units in parallel. With a CAN-Bridge, the system can be expanded to as many as 64 units.
  • What is the expected cycle life?
  • The batteries are rated for at least 6,000 cycles under the specified test conditions.
  • What depth of discharge is supported?
  • Depending on the model, the recommended depth of discharge is 80% or 90% DoD.
  • Can the batteries be wall mounted?
  • Yes. The SE-F Series supports wall-mounted, floor-mounted, and stack-mounted installation configurations.
  • Does the battery support smart monitoring?
  • Yes. Communication options include CAN2.0 and RS485, with Bluetooth and APP monitoring available depending on the selected model.
  • What is the operating temperature range?
  • The series supports discharge operation from -20°C to 55°C. Charging temperature limits depend on the selected model and configuration.
  • Which models have IP65 protection?
  • The SE-F12 Max and SE-F16 Max are listed with an IP65 enclosure rating, while other models in the series are listed as IP21.
  • What warranty is provided?
  • The SE-F5 has a 5-year warranty, while SE-F5 Plus, SE-F5 Pro, SE-F12, SE-F12 Max, SE-F16, and SE-F16 Max are listed with a 10-year warranty, subject to Deye warranty conditions.
  • Can the battery be monitored without an internet connection?
  • Selected SE-F models support Bluetooth local monitoring, allowing quick pairing and local battery monitoring without requiring an internet connection.
